When considering discs for my D44 I thought about going with Crown Vic stuff because it was pretty much a bolt on but....the asymmetry of the caliper mounting just plain bugged me!
I could have flipped the one side but, then you have one e-brake cable above and one below and you'd have to remove the upside down one to bleed it, plus....I'm really into symmetry!
Went with Explorer stuff instead....a little more work (welded and redrilled XJ pattern on the brackets) but, well worth the extra effort.
I also used the Explorer flex lines and mounted it to a couple of bolts welded to the axle tubes for a pretty clean looking install (the Explorer line I found was way longer than the XJ line and allowed for extra droop).
Also, I've found that a .230" piece of schedule 40 pipe (can't remember the size) was a perfect spacer for the retainer plate.
Just split the spacer and a couple of tack welds after you stick it between the retainer plate and the bearing and you'r egood to go!
For the e-brake I modified a couple of passenger side Explorer cables and the stock XJ cables.
Don't forget to adress the proportioning valve....just swap Grand Cherokee guts (plunger, spring and end cap) to your XJ's valve, makes a noticeable difference
